The northern B.C. developer who has built a rodeo ground on his farmland after the Agriculture Land Commission rejected the development says he fears no legal repercussions.
“What are they going to do? Put a roadblock across and stop the people from coming onto my land?” said Fort St. John landowner Terry McLeod, who held a rodeo over the summer and hosted the RCMP’s musical ride.
And with only one officer now dedicated to enforcing the independent Crown agency’s decisions in all of British Columbia, McLeod may just be right.
